Transaction 46382ee1b56f360f604e12f413a603dbdccbf55ede28544825c6e24e8095fa9d
1 Input
1 Output
-
46382ee1b56f360f604e12f413a603dbdccbf55ede28544825c6e24e8095fa9d:0
- value
- 29018193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d9f55a3816c8d00bfe0482a3eabdfdd9661f19b OP_EQUAL
- address
- MLozPEbbGmUPHPj1mNGLhEvvJdZEsECPmE